Two men have been shot and killed, and two females have been injured on a residential street in Long Beach after a horrific shooting late Friday night.
Members of the Long Beach Police Department are confirming to Hews Media Group-Community Newspaper that on at approximately 9:54 PM last night, officers were dispatched to a report of gunshots in the 6500 block of Rose Avenue.
Officers arrived and discovered two male adult victims with “apparent gunshots wounds and died at the scene.” Two female adult gunshot victims were transported to a local hospital.
The Los Angeles County Coroner’s Office will confirm the victims’ identities. The scene is located near Carson Street between Orange and Cherry Avenue.
